Output 89ef61d9f9b033a8a7e06fcb10b3b8df3563a8d3b5ab0865e1a81099ff08cbd4:0

value
1788105
script pubkey
OP_0 OP_PUSHBYTES_20 8f405fd8ce961a7d489e2b37908b791b389a816e
address
tb1q3aq9lkxwjcd86jy79vmepzmervuf4qtwufhmld
transaction
89ef61d9f9b033a8a7e06fcb10b3b8df3563a8d3b5ab0865e1a81099ff08cbd4